Position Title
Network Engineer LeadLocation
Nationwide, MI 48098Job Summary
The Network Engineer, Lead, works under minimal supervision to provide direct oversight of the Network Engineering team to insure that technology standards and operational processes are successfully executed.Job Responsibilities:
JOB RESPONSIBILITIES
- Leads the planning, forecasting, implementation, and identification of resource requirements for network systems, including wireless and wireline voice and data, systems of moderate to high complexity.
- Integrates and schematically depicts voice and data communication architectures, topologies, hardware, software, transmission and signaling links and protocols into complete network configurations.
- Monitors protocol compatibility, performs system tuning and makes recommendations for improvement.
- Develops integrated solutions to resolve highly complex technical and business issues.
- Leads network planning and is instrumental in network architecture design and engineering.
- Evaluates new products, performs network problem resolution and assists in the development and documentation of technical standards and interface applications.
- Performs work that is highly complex and varied in nature.
- Recognized expert internally and externally within a discipline(s) and often provides strategic direction, guidance and integration of products and services.
- May lead projects and provide guidance/training to more junior staff.
- Requires mastery of technical and business knowledge in multiple disciplines/processes.
- Provides training and guidance to the Engineering team regarding operational processes.
- Provides leadership in fostering teamwork and cooperation.
- Provides central point of communications for the Engineering team.

On December 1, 2022, New York Community Bank (NYCB) and Flagstar Bank joined together to become one company. Today, New York Community Bancorp, Inc. is the parent company of Flagstar Bank, N.A., one of the largest regional banks in the country. The company is headquartered in Hicksville, New York. At June 30, 2024, the company had assets of $119.1 billion. We operate over 400 branches across 10 states, including a significant presence in the Northeast and Midwest and locations in high growth markets in the Southeast and on the West Coast. Flagstar Mortgage operates nationally through a wholesale network of approximately 3,000 third-party mortgage originators.
